What Benefits Are Executive Talent Expecting?

In a highly competitive business landscape, attracting and retaining top executive talent is essential for an organization’s success. Companies must provide attractive benefits to their executives to ensure that they remain motivated, engaged, and committed to achieving the company’s goals. Here are some key benefits that companies should offer to stay competitive in the executive talent market:

Competitive Compensation Packages

Executives expect competitive base salaries, performance-based bonuses, and equity options. Competitive compensation not only attracts top talent but also incentivizes them to perform at their best.

Health and Wellness Benefits

Comprehensive health insurance, wellness programs, and access to top-tier medical facilities can help executives maintain their well-being and productivity.

Retirement Plans

Comprehensive retirement plans, such as 401(k)s with generous employer contributions, help executives secure their financial future, making your company more attractive.

Stock Options and Equity Grants

Offering stock options and equity grants aligns executives’ interests with the long-term success of the company. This can motivate them to drive the company’s growth and profitability.

Performance-Based Incentives

Performance-based incentives, such as annual bonuses and profit-sharing, reward executives for achieving strategic objectives and financial targets.

Flexible Work Arrangements

Executives often have demanding schedules, so offering flexible work arrangements, including remote work options or flexible hours, can help them achieve a work-life balance.

Professional Development and Education

Supporting executives in pursuing professional development opportunities, including further education or executive training programs, can enhance their leadership skills and keep them competitive.

Mentorship and Coaching

Providing access to mentorship and executive coaching programs can help executives continue to grow and develop as leaders.

Company Car or Transportation Benefits

Offering company cars or transportation allowances can ease the logistical burdens on executives, making their work more efficient.

Vacation and Paid Time Off

A generous vacation policy and paid time off allow executives to recharge, reducing burnout and improving their productivity when they return to work.

Relocation Assistance

If the company requires executives to relocate, offering relocation assistance can help ease the transition and make the opportunity more appealing.

Family and Dependent Care Support

Executives with families may appreciate benefits like child-care assistance or family health coverage.

Exclusive Perks and Benefits

Consider offering unique perks such as access to exclusive clubs, memberships, or travel opportunities that add value to the executive’s experience with the company.

Succession Planning

Executives often want a clear path for career progression within the organization. A well-defined succession plan can demonstrate the company’s commitment to its growth.
